GEOFF I. BRADLEY, AICP

President + principal

Geoff has over 30 years of professional public and private experience working with a variety of architectural, planning, development firms and public agencies. Prior to the formation of M-Group, this included 10 years of public sector experience with Bay Area planning and redevelopment agencies. Geoff has worked with numerous jurisdictions throughout the Bay Area. His work includes downtown revitalization, major commercial, mixed-use, transit-oriented projects, as well as updates of General Plans, Housing Elements and Zoning Codes.

Geoff is a results-oriented planning professional with a strong design background in architecture, urban design and landscape architecture. He is highly motivated to work to improve our natural and man-made places with an ability to combine innovative ideas with pragmatic solutions, and work with a wide variety of stakeholders on achieving community goals. Geoff has a passion for improving cities through urban planning with a focus on equity and inclusion.

Geoff holds a B.S. in City and Regional Planning and an M.S. in Architecture, from Cal Poly, San Luis Obispo. Geoff also attended The University of Sheffield in England for one year studying Urban Studies and Landscape Architecture.
